We can’t drop off packages of Bullets we manufacture because they can’t or perhaps just don’t want to learn. A bullet by itself is in no way a regulated item like gun powder, primers or even loaded ammo. Sadly we’ve taken the hazmat certification course and know what limits there are. All our loaded products go directly to the main customer service center or our diver picks that up since it’s a regulated shipment and requires the “ORM-D” sticker as required. We initiate the label and thus the responsibility falls on us as the shipper, not the store. This was even confirmed with UPS corporate on the phone standing in the store with the owner on the Call.
